Thank you and Regards, Now in latest build. Ignore the version listed on website. It's currently V2.7.6.6 If the commands for those requests aren't accepted, feel free to post the kind of verbiage you'd be using and the speech grammar would be updated accordingly. Right now, here are some variants. Words between parenthesis arte optional Tell (the) controller we are on downwind Advise (the)controller we are on downwind Inform (the) tower we are on downwind Replace "downwind" with "base leg", "left base", "right base", "final", "short final", or "long final" for other requests.
